C. Calpurnius Piso L.f. Frugi (67 or 61 BC). AR denarius (17mm, 3.80 gm, 5h). NGC AU 5/5 - 3/5, light scratch. Rome, 67 BC. Head of Apollo right, wearing taenia; arrow or spearhead behind / C•PISO•L•F•FRVG, rider on horse galloping right, reins in right hand, palm in left; ivy leaf above, uncertain leaf below palm. Crawford 408/1b. Note - Although obverse and reverse control marks for this type typically correspond, there is no apparent connection between the control marks of this lot.
